引言
随着数字化转型的浪潮席卷全球,编程技能变得越来越重要。然而,对于许多非技术人士来说,学习编程似乎是一项遥不可及的任务。幸运的是,低代码平台的兴起为这些人提供了一个全新的学习途径。本文将深入探讨低代码平台的特点、优势以及如何帮助非技术人士轻松入门编程。
低代码平台概述
什么是低代码平台?
低代码平台(Low-Code Platforms)是一种允许用户通过图形界面和配置而非传统的编码来创建应用程序的工具。这些平台通常提供拖放式界面,用户可以通过拖放组件和配置参数来构建应用程序,而无需编写大量代码。
低代码平台的特点
- 可视化开发:用户可以通过图形界面进行应用程序的开发,无需编写代码。
- 模块化:平台提供各种预构建的模块,如数据库连接、用户界面组件等,用户可以根据需要组合这些模块。
- 易于使用:低代码平台通常具有直观的用户界面,使得非技术人士也能轻松上手。
- 快速迭代:由于开发周期短,低代码平台能够快速响应业务需求的变化。
低代码平台的优势
降低技术门槛
低代码平台的最大优势在于降低了编程的技术门槛。非技术人士可以通过平台提供的可视化工具,快速掌握应用程序的开发过程。
提高开发效率
低代码平台通过简化开发流程,大大提高了开发效率。用户可以快速构建原型,并在短时间内将想法转化为现实。
促进创新
低代码平台使得更多非技术人士参与到应用程序的开发过程中,从而促进了创新。
降低成本
由于开发周期短,低代码平台可以降低开发成本。
低代码平台的应用场景
企业内部应用
- CRM系统:低代码平台可以帮助企业快速构建定制化的CRM系统,提高客户服务效率。
- ERP系统:低代码平台可以用于构建企业资源计划系统,优化企业内部管理流程。
移动应用开发
- 移动应用:低代码平台可以用于快速开发移动应用,满足用户在不同场景下的需求。
教育领域
- 编程教育:低代码平台可以帮助学生和教师轻松入门编程,提高编程学习效率。
低代码平台的挑战
技术限制
低代码平台在处理复杂业务逻辑时可能存在技术限制。
依赖平台
使用低代码平台开发的应用程序可能受到平台更新和限制的影响。
人才短缺
随着低代码平台的普及,相关人才的需求也在不断增加。
总结
低代码平台为非技术人士提供了一个全新的编程学习途径,使得编程梦想不再遥不可及。尽管存在一些挑战,但低代码平台的发展前景依然广阔。随着技术的不断进步,低代码平台将为更多人带来编程的乐趣和便利。
